WebA significant benefit for AOPA members in the Sport Pilot rule is the ability to utilize a driver's license in lieu of a medical certificate. This allows pilots, who are otherwise healthy but who choose to not renew their medical certificate, to continue flying in light sport aircraft. Single-engine Piston. 1977 Piper PA-28R-201 Arrow III. $124,900. shs reunionWebFree flight is the segment of model aviation involving aircraft with no active external control after launch. Free Flight is the original form of hobby aeromodeling, with the competitive objective being to build and launch a self controlling aircraft that will consistently achieve the longest flight duration over multiple competition rounds, within various class … shsrockportWebMar 13, 2024 · 2024 TL SPORT AIRCRAFT TL-2000 STING S4 $225,000 Reg# Not Listed TT: 4 Performance Specs The Jubilee is our commemorative 500th Sting S4 aircraft.
